Aluminium Windows

Aluminium windows are a popular choice for homeowners due to their durability, versatility, and sleek aesthetics.

Features of

Aluminium Windows

Strength and Durability

Aluminium is a strong and durable material, providing excellent structural integrity to windows. It is resistant to rust, corrosion, and weathering, allowing these windows to withstand harsh environmental conditions without deteriorating. This durability ensures that aluminium windows have a long lifespan.

Slim Profiles

Aluminium frames can be manufactured with slim profiles, offering a sleek and modern aesthetic. The slimline design allows for larger glass areas, maximizing natural light and providing unobstructed views. This feature enhances the visual appeal of the windows and allows more daylight to enter the living space.

Design Versatility

They offer design versatility, allowing homeowners to choose from various styles and configurations to suit their needs and preferences. They can be designed as casement windows, sliding windows, awning windows, or even bi-fold windows, offering flexibility in functionality and appearance.

Powder-Coating Options

Aluminium frames can be powder-coated with a wide range of colours and finishes. This provides homeowners with the freedom to match their windows to their home’s exterior or interior design, allowing for customization and personalization.

Thermal Efficiency

Modern aluminium windows incorporate thermal break technology, where a non-conductive material is inserted within the frame to reduce heat transfer. This improves the thermal efficiency of the windows, helping to prevent heat loss during colder months and heat gain during warmer months. The enhanced insulation can contribute to energy savings and a more comfortable living environment.

Security Features

Can be equipped with advanced locking systems and security features, ensuring the safety and security of your home. The inherent strength of aluminium frames provides an additional layer of protection against forced entry.

Sound Insulation

Aluminium frames have inherent sound-dampening properties, helping to reduce external noise and creating a quieter indoor environment.

Environmental Sustainability

Aluminium is a highly recyclable material, making these windows an eco-friendly choice. When it comes to replacement or disposal, aluminium frames can be recycled repeatedly without losing their quality, reducing waste and the demand for new raw materials.

Supercraft Windows

Supercraft Aluminium Windows

Discover how the right windows can transform both the interior and exterior of your house, and let the beauty of natural light fill your living spaces.

Benefits of

Aluminium Windows

These windows offer several benefits that make them a popular choice for homeowners


Opting for aluminium windows contributes to reducing waste and the demand for new raw materials.

Energy Efficiency

Highly energy-efficient when designed with thermal break technology and energy-efficient glazing options.


Built to withstand harsh weather conditions, including strong winds, rain, and UV exposure.

Low Maintenance

Aluminium is resistant to corrosion, rust, and fading, so there is no need for regular painting or staining.

